Ingredients: |
|
|
1/3 cup sugar
1/2 cup sour cream
1/4 tsp. vanilla
1 tbsp. sour cream
1 tbsp. brandy
2 tbsp. sugar
1/3 cup finely chopped nuts
4 pears, halved
1 tbsp. lemon juice
1/3 cup water
1 tbsp. sugar
|
Directions:
|
Preheat oven to 325°F. Mix 1/3 cup sugar, the water and lemon juice in ungreased square pan, until sugar dissolves. Arranges pears in pan, turning to coat with sugar mixture. Cover and bake in oven until pears are almost tender when pierced with fork, about 25 minutes.
Please 1 pear half cut side up in each of 8 serving dishes. Mix nuts, 2 tbsp. sugar, the brandy, 1 tbsp. sour cream and the vanilla; fill centers of pear halves with nut mixture. Mix sour cream and 1 tbsp. sugar. Top each pear half and dollop of sour cream mixture.
